Saint Clair gets about 44 inches of precipitation a year. That kind of rain can wash loose mulch off slopes and out of beds if the layer is too thin or not edged. Planning the right depth and a solid border keeps the material where you put it.

Mulch does more than look neat. It keeps roots cool, holds moisture, and stops weeds from seeding. The table below matches each project with the right product and depth.
| Project | What to order | Depth or note |
|---|---|---|
| Slope where mulch washes out | Shredded Hardwood Mulch | 3 to 4 inches; use coarse, interlocking material. |
| Tree rings | Shredded Hardwood Mulch | 2 inches; keep mulch off trunk. |
| New planting beds | Shredded Hardwood Mulch | 2 to 3 inches after soil is prepped. |
| Refreshing existing beds | Shredded Hardwood Mulch | 1 inch top-dress over old layer. |
| Weed suppression | Shredded Hardwood Mulch | 3 to 4 inches to block light. |
Saint Clair gets about 44 inches of precipitation a year, and roughly 72 days bring at least a tenth of an inch of rain. That frequent wetting speeds mulch breakdown and makes scheduling deliveries onto firm ground important. Most of this work runs spring to fall, and the ground is workable for most of that stretch.
The area sees about 105 days a year when the temperature drops below 32F, and about 11 inches of snow. Freeze-thaw cycles can shift loose mulch, and plowing may scatter a shallow layer. A 3-inch depth helps keep it in place over the winter. Ground freezing here is moderate, so the work window starts when the soil thaws and lasts until it freezes again.
Soils around Saint Clair belong to hydrologic group C, meaning they take water in slowly and shed a fair amount across the surface. That runoff can carry mulch away, which is why a deeper drainage layer earns its place on slopes and around foundations.

For weed suppression, go 3 to 4 inches. For established beds, 2 to 3 inches works. Tree rings need only 2 inches, and you keep the mulch off the trunk. If the ground is sloped, a thicker layer on the uphill side helps hold it.
